About Stiftelsen Serbisk Kultursenter

To preserve, support and further develop Serbian cultural heritage and the identity of Serbian society in Norway and Scandinavia.. To organise a number of activities and programmes in the fields of music, art, literature, dance, drama, sport and other similar fields, especially of children and young people, carried out in different locations throughout the country. To organise a range of activities and programmes in. education and science, specifically targeted at children and young people, in cooperation. with various Serbian and Norwegian educational institutions. To make Norwegian public awareness of Serbian culture, artistic, scientific and other content, as well as Serbian heritage and creative performances. To support the exchange of Serbian and Norwegian cultural workers, artists, athletes, athletes, educational and scientific …

Stiftelsen Serbisk Kultursenter is registered in Norway. Donations of at least 500 NOK (up to 50,000 NOK per year) to approved Norwegian nonprofits are tax-deductible. The organization must be registered in the Volunteer Register and report donations to the Norwegian Tax Administration.
